Its the HTC branded 2150 battery, so it should add about 40%... from what Battery Boss said in their ratings, this battery achieved 100% of its advertised power rating, so I expect to go from 6 hours heavy use to 9 hours heavy use... 14 hours moderate use to 20 hours moderate use... and 26 hours light use to 38 hours light use... so long story short I expect to get a day and a half of use out of this thing before even thinking of a recharge... I guess only time will tell if the added bulk kills me... but ultimately I am sick of these phones having such amazing features and the battery life dwindling down to crap... give me a phone that goes a solid 2 days without recharging so I never feel that I cant use my phone in an emergency...
